Q: Is 293,104 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 293,104 is a composite number.

Why is 293,104 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 293,104 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 8 14 16 28 56 112 2,617 5,234 10,468 18,319 20,936 36,638 41,872 73,276 146,552 and 293,104, with no remainder.

Since 293,104 cannot be divided by just 1 and 293,104, it is a composite number.
